“In one thousand trials it is not five hundred of them that work for the believers good, but nine hundred and ninety-nine of them, and one beside.” –George Mueller

For good reason, Romans 8:28 is a favorite verse of many. In fact, some consider this to be the greatest verse in the entire Bible. If we take it at face value, it tells us that nothing happens outside of Gods plan for our good. That’s a tremendous promise to stand on when life doesn’t feel so good. That’s a solid hope to hold on to through the storm.

Of suffering and adversity, the great “Prince of Preachers” Charles Spurgeon said, Most of the grand truths of God have to be learned by trouble they must be burned into us with the hot iron of affliction, otherwise we shall not truly receive them.

Our life in Christ is based on Gods good purposes, and that includes suffering:

“For as we share abundantly in Christs sufferings, so through Christ we share abundantly in comfort too.” 2 Corinthians 1:5

We share in these sufferings because we share Christ and because we live in a fallen world ruled at the present time by evil forces that are opposed to God and his purposes.

God doesn’t allow disaster or permit evil randomly. Joni Eareckson Tada, who became a quadriplegic after a skiing accident, said, “God permits what He hates to achieve what He loves.”

A Promise For Our Good

Romans 8:28 is a promise that rang true for Dr. Ward, as it has been true for Christians throughout history.

And we know that in all things God works for the good of those who love him, who have been called according to his purpose. Romans 8:28

The Living Bible translation words it this way: And we know that all that happens to us is working for our good if we love God and are fitting into his plans.

The Apostle Paul wrote the book of Romans, which many consider to be the most rich theological treatise in Scripture. He begins chapter 8 by discussing the differences between living by the Spirit and living by the flesh. He points out that living by the Spirit makes us sons and daughters of God.

The Spirit himself testifies with our spirit that we are Gods children. Now if we are children, then we are heirsheirs of God and co-heirs with Christ, if indeed we share in his sufferings in order that we may also share in his glory. Romans 8:16, 17

Then Paul compares the sufferings that we face in this life with the glory that will be revealed in us . He entreats us to wait patiently and to trust that the Spirit intercedes for us when we dont know what to pray for.

Assurance Of God’s Care For Christians

The assertion of providence in Romans 8:28 is specific and directed only to Christians. God rules over everything and everyonebelievers and unbelieversbut his oversight is different in the case of believers. To themand them onlyGod’s providence works “for good.” The unwritten logical implication is that providence confirms the blessing of some and the doom of others. For those “who love God,” providence is directed to achieve “good.” Who are “those who love God”? They are “those who are called according to purpose.” The promise is given for those who are “called” by God into fellowship with Jesus Christ. Writing to the Corinthians, Paul addresses them as “the church of God that is in Corinth, . . . those sanctified in Christ Jesus, called to be saints” . We could equally render the final phrase “called to be holy” or even “the holy called ones.”

Third The Importance Of The Verse Following Romans : 28

For those God foreknew, He also predestined to be conformed to the likeness of his Son, that he might be the firstborn among many brothers .

A wise Bible teacher once told me, God allows everything into our lives for one of two purposeseither to bring us into a relationship with himself or, if we already know him, to make us more like His Son.

My friend Billy was diagnosed with a brain tumor at age 35. Billy played college baseball, married his sweetheart, and fathered two handsome sons. Convinced of the truth of Romans 8:28 and 29, he chose to believe God had a good plan for his bad cancer.

Because Billy believed God could use even something as destructive as a brain tumor, he responded in faith and trust. Even though this is not what I planned for my life, he told his family, I trust God to use it for good. His unshakeable faith and peace were so profound that church leaders asked him to share his story at a mens event.

Billy agreed. Then he invited his younger brother, Jack, to go with him. Jack had never accepted any of Billys invitations to go to church, but this time, he said yes.

When Billy finished telling his story, the pastor invited attendees to come forward if they wanted to know how to have a relationship with God. Jack was the first person out of his seat.

Ive always thought Billys faith was a crutch, Jack said, but watching him go through three surgeries, chemotherapy, and radiation made me realize what he had was real. And I wanted it.

And We Know That All Things Work Together For Good

Romans 8:28 Poster All Things Work Together Bible Verse Quote Wall Art ...

There is a sense of security in knowing.

Imagine a loved one who leaves the house early in the morning for work but forgets to take his or her cell phone. Then, unbeknownst to you, your loved one is asked to stay on the job for an extra hour or two. You are worried sick about your loved one! But when the person finally arrives home and walks through that door, the concern vanishes, and you breathe a sigh of relief. You know he or she is safe.

Knowing brings comfort and peace, but not knowingliving in the unknownmakes it all too easy for doubt, fear and worry to creep in.

For that reason, it is worth noting that Paul did not say we think or we hope.

On the contrary, we can knowbe certain, surethat all things work together for good.

But what things was Paul referring to?

He explained a few verses earlier, For I consider that the sufferings of this present time are not worthy to be compared with the glory which shall be revealed in us .

Primarily, Paul was talking about the sufferingsthe trials, problemsthat we deal with in life.

Without a doubt, our world is brimful of all kinds of problems. There are relationship problems, marriage problems, financial problems, health problems, mental problems, self-esteem problems, work problems and school problems. The list could go on and on.

The point is that Paul understood suffering as well as anyone. If there was any person who had reason to wonder whether or notall things work together for good, it was Paul.
